This stick cylinder seal kit is designed to replace the worn seals within the hydraulic stick cylinder, preventing fluid leaks and maintaining proper hydraulic system pressure. It is constructed from high-quality sealing materials that resist wear and degradation, unlike failed seals which allow hydraulic fluid to escape. Operators may observe a slow or jerky movement of the stick, external hydraulic fluid leaks around the cylinder, or a loss of lifting/digging power if this seal kit is compromised.

The first indication of failing stick cylinder seals is often a slight external hydraulic fluid leak around the cylinder rod or slower-than-normal stick operation. If ignored, the leaks will worsen, and the cylinder's performance will degrade further, leading to reduced digging force and potential system contamination. Continued operation risks significant hydraulic system damage and operational downtime.
Thoroughly clean the cylinder bore and piston rod, removing all traces of old seal material and debris. Ensure new seals are properly lubricated with system-compatible hydraulic oil before installation to prevent tearing.
Inspect the cylinder rod for scoring or pitting, and check the hydraulic fluid for contamination when replacing stick cylinder seals.
